Identifying Common Sprinkler Issues



A well-maintained sprinkler system is critical for efficient lawn care, however also the ideal systems can experience issues. One constant trouble is low water pressure, which can cause uneven watering and dry patches on your yard.


An additional widespread concern is sprinkler heads that do not turn up or pull back effectively. This breakdown might be as a result of particles blocking the device or a damaged springtime. Additionally, misaligned sprinkler heads can result in water being sprayed onto sidewalks, driveways, or other unintentional areas, leading to water wastage and insufficient coverage of your lawn.

Cleansing and Unclogging Nozzles



When dealing with usual sprinkler problems, attending to clogs is vital for preserving optimum system efficiency. In time, debris such as dust, lawn cuttings, and mineral down payments can build up within the nozzles, obstructing water flow and lowering irrigation efficiency. To ensure your sprinklers operate efficiently, regular cleaning and unclogging of nozzles is important.


Begin by turning off the irrigation system to avoid any type of unexpected water discharge. Very carefully eliminate the nozzle from the lawn sprinkler head. This may require making use of a little screwdriver or a specialized nozzle elimination device. When detached, examine the nozzle for visible particles. Make use of a fine needle or a tiny wire to dislodge any kind of blockages within the nozzle's opening. For complete cleaning, soak the nozzle in a combination of water and vinegar or a business cleansing option developed to dissolve mineral down payments.


Rinse the nozzle under running water to get rid of any type of remaining particles and reattach it to the lawn sprinkler head. Turn the system back on and observe the water circulation to guarantee the blockage has actually been removed. Regular upkeep of sprinkler nozzles can dramatically improve the long life and efficiency of your watering system.


Replacing Broken Lawn Sprinkler Heads



Replacing busted sprinkler heads is a critical action in maintaining an effective irrigation system. When hop over to here a lawn sprinkler head comes to be damaged, it can bring about water wastefulness and unequal coverage, which can negatively influence the health of your grass or garden. The initial step is to identify the malfunctioning head, commonly apparent via uneven water spray patterns or water pooling around the base.


Begin by transforming off the water system to stop any type of unneeded splilling. Use a shovel to thoroughly dig around the lawn sprinkler head, guaranteeing you do not damage the surrounding piping. As soon as exposed, unscrew the damaged try this out head from the riser, keeping in mind of the make and design to guarantee you purchase a compatible replacement.


Screw the new sprinkler head onto the riser by hand, guaranteeing it is snug yet not excessively limited to prevent damaging the threads. Transform the water supply back on and evaluate the brand-new head to ensure it is working correctly, making adjustments as needed.

After fine-tuning the water pressure and protection, it is similarly essential to integrate routine upkeep practices to make certain the longevity and efficiency of your sprinkler system. Begin with a seasonal inspection to find any visible wear or damages. Take a look at lawn sprinkler heads for clogs, leaks, or imbalance, and tidy or replace them as needed. Make certain that all nozzles are devoid of debris to stop water flow obstruction.


Next, look for leakages in the irrigation lines. Small leaks can rise into considerable concerns if left unaddressed. Display the water pressure during operation; fluctuations can show hidden leakages or clogs. Change damaged or damaged parts quickly to prevent additional difficulties.




Readjust the system's timer setups according to seasonal water requirements. Overwatering or underwatering can damage your landscape and waste resources. Additionally, check the rainfall sensing unit and ensure it is functioning properly to avoid unnecessary watering throughout rains.
